Recreated had some issues with playstyle on Astrologer so im on Vagabond now and looking up guides for it

It’s probably the best noob class. Straightforward. Hold the shield button down and scream. Use the guard counter.

Highly recommend not to look guides on how to play a class. Especially in Elden ring. You should find a way to play the class the way you want to. There are people using a halberd and doing call of duty jumps with it and they feel good with it and the guides tell you to poke enemies with the halberd.

I agree. In all these games you just level up the stats that fit how you like to play. The only universal stat in this one is endurance. You look at a cloud and it drains stamina.

No need to look things up. Just know vagabond starts with a 100% physical damage resistance shield. It will give you time to block most enemies until you figure out there attack patterns.

Confessor has a 100% phys reduction shield too if you want to be a paladin style.
